  • Jim Cramer: Tech Stocks Losing Their Rally Leadership Qualities

    Tech stocks, previously market leaders, face challenges as AI-driven capital raises and infrastructure spending dilute prior strengths. Aggressive buybacks and lean balance sheets are giving way to increased stock supply from new AI IPOs and established giants funding AI development. This shift from scarcity to potential oversupply raises concerns about valuations and necessitates a more cautious investor approach.

  • Jim Cramer: Excess Supply Threatens Bull Market

    A wave of capital raises for AI infrastructure could pressure the stock market. A surge in new stock offerings from tech giants, including anticipated IPOs from SpaceX, Anthropic, and OpenAI, alongside Alphabet’s $80 billion sale, risks overwhelming investor demand. Analysts warn of a supply-demand imbalance, potentially forcing investors to liquidate existing positions, impacting even companies like Nvidia. While near-term volatility is expected, the long-term AI investment thesis remains strong.
